Abstract in different language: | The human phonation is highly interesting phenomenon, where numerical simulations play an important role due to the practical inaccessibility of the vocal folds. This phenomenon is described by three physical fields ? the deformation of elastic body, the complex fluid flow and the acoustics together with mutual couplings. The description and results of fluid-structure interaction (FSI) is here taken from over and this paper focuses on the acoustic part of problem described by the acoustic analogies. |
